Ryan Adams & The Cardinals
2008-09-30
Cleveland, OH - Palace Theatre
Ryan Adams - guitar, vocals
Neal Casal - guitar, vocals
Chris Feinstein - bass, vocals
Jon Graboff - pedal steel, vocals
Brad Pemberton - drums, vocals
Taper: spyboychoir (spyboychoir@gmail.com)
Source: SBD > Kind Kables > Edirol R-09HR (24/48)
Conversion: R-09HR > USB > Sound Studio 3.5.7 > WAV > xACT 1.62 > FLAC (level 8)
Format: 16bit, 44.1kHz
Editing: Sound Studio 3.5.7 (tracking, fades, normalization to peak (-0.2dB), resample, dither)

Reviewer: spyboychoir - - October 14, 2008
Subject: Venue Information
To JM3756:
You are partially correct. The Palace Theatre in Cleveland, OH is one of several venues that reside in Playhouse Square. So, yes, Ryan did play the Palace two nights in a row - once in Columbus, then in Cleveland.
